Polish

Etymology

Learned borrowing from Latin amphora, from Ancient Greek ἀμφορεύς (amphoreús).[1] First attested in the 19th century.[2]

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/amˈfɔ.ra/
  • (file)
  • Rhymes: -ɔra
  • Syllabification: am‧fo‧ra

Noun

amfora f

  1. (historical) amphora (type of jar)
    gliniana amforaclay amphora
    grecka amforaGreek amphora
    starożytna amforaancient amphora
    piękna amforabeautiful amphora
    amfora kulistaspherical amphora
    fragment amforyfragment of an amphora
    kształt amforyshape of an amphora
    zdobić amforęto adorn an amphora
    przypominać amforęto resemble an amphora
    amfora pochodzi skądśan amphora comes from somewhere

Turkish

Alternative forms

  • amfor (obsolete)

Etymology

From French amphore, from Latin amphora, from Ancient Greek ἀμφορεύς (amphoreús).

Noun

amfora (definite accusative amforayı, plural amforalar)

  1. amphora
